Introduction

This project is for the High Performance Computing for Data Science course at the University of Trento (2025).

It involves the parallelization of the Expectation-Maximization (EM) algorithm for clustering using Gaussian Mixture Models (GMM). Two parallel implementations are provided:

  • MPI: Distributed memory parallelization
  • OpenMP: Shared memory parallelization

The EM algorithm alternates between an E-step (computing cluster membership probabilities) and an M-step (updating means, covariances, and weights) until convergence.

Tested configurations:

  • N: 50,000 – 500,000 points
  • D: 6 – 8 dimensions
  • K: 5 – 15 clusters

Prerequisites

  • C compiler compatible with C11 or higher (GCC recommended)
  • CMake (version 3.10 or higher)
  • MPI library (OpenMPI or MPICH) for the MPI version
  • R (optional, for plotting results)

Quick Start

  1. Clone the repository

    git clone https://github.com/martinadep/parallel_EM_clustering
    cd parallel_EM_clustering
  2. Build the project

    mkdir -p build && cd build
    cmake ..
    make
  3. Run the algorithm

    mpirun -np 4 ./build/em_clustering_[version] \
        -d datasets/test/gmm_P50000_K5_D6.csv \
        -k 5 \
        -o results/output.csv

    Or, using shell scripts in scripts/ (recommended).

  4. (Optional) Plot the results

    Rscript generator_and_analysis/plot_em_results.R

Usage

Command Line Flags

Flag Description
-d Input CSV file (required)
-k Number of clusters (required)
-o Output file for results
-m Max iterations (default: 100)
-t Convergence threshold
